工程师主管面试题题库解析.docxVIP

工程师主管面试题题库解析.docx

此“教育”领域文档为创作者个人分享资料,不作为权威性指导和指引,仅供参考
  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

工程师主管面试题题库解析

面试问答题(共20题)

第一题

请描述一下你在以往的项目经历中,遇到过最具挑战性的技术难题是什么?请详细说明:

该问题的具体内容是什么?

你是如何分析并着手解决这个问题的?(包括你采取了哪些步骤、使用了哪些工具/技术、团队是如何协作的)

最终解决了什么?结果如何?

从这个经历中,你个人和团队学到了什么?对后续的项目管理或技术决策有何影响?

答案:

由于这是一个开放性问题,答案会因面试者的实际经历而异。一个好的答案通常应包含以下要素,并体现出结构化思维、解决问题的能力、技术深度、团队协作和反思能力:

描述问题情境(清晰具体):

说清楚是在哪个项目、哪个阶段遇到的。

明确问题是什么,问题的具体表现是什么(例如:性能瓶颈、系统崩溃、安全漏洞、需求无法满足、技术路障等)。

说明问题的严重性和影响(对项目进度、成本、质量、用户体验等的影响)。

示例:“在XX项目中,我们遇到了一个严重的数据库查询性能瓶颈,导致高峰期系统响应时间超过5秒,用户投诉量大,影响了核心业务目标的达成。”

分析问题与解决过程(方法和深度):

描述你是如何进行问题定位的?(例如:通过监控工具分析、日志排查、压力测试、代码审查、理论分析等)。

说明你采取的具体解决方案是什么,这个方案为什么可行?(需要体现技术决策的依据,可能涉及算法优化、架构调整、技术选型、代码重构、引入新工具/库等)。

描述解决过程中可能遇到的困难以及如何克服的。

强调团队协作:是如何与其他工程师、测试工程师、产品经理沟通协作的?是否开了技术评审会?如何获取或提供帮助?

示例:“我首先通过APM工具定位到是几个复杂的关联查询导致CPU和IO飙升。然后组织团队成员一起进行了代码审查和慢查询分析,发现可以通过添加部分索引、优化SQL语句逻辑、甚至将部分数据缓存到Redis中来解决。我主导了Redis方案的设计和实施,并协调资源进行部署和压力测试。过程中遇到带宽瓶颈,我们与运维同事沟通解决了。”

结果与影响(量化与验证):

明确说明问题最终是如何解决的。

用结果来证明你的解决方案是有效的(尽可能量化,例如:响应时间从5秒降低到0.5秒,系统崩溃次数从每天多次降低到零,开发成本节约XX%)。

说明该解决方案对项目或业务带来的正面影响。

示例:“最终,通过这些优化措施,系统响应时间稳定在0.5秒以下,满足了SLA要求,用户满意度显著提升,并且使得我们后续的功能迭代能更从容地承载流量。”

经验教训与反思(成长与提升):

描述个人从这个过程中学到了什么?(技术层面、解决复杂问题的思路、沟通方式等)。

描述团队从中吸取了什么教训?(例如:测试流程需要加强、上线前需要更充分的压力测试、文档的重要性等)。

说明这些经验如何影响了你后续的项目管理风格、技术决策或团队建设?(例如:更注重PREM理念、推动自动化测试建设、在技术选型时更考虑可扩展性和维护性等)。

示例:“我个人学到了在面临复杂性能问题时,系统性分析工具和团队协作的重要性。团队意识到自动化性能测试和CI/CD流程中性能门禁的必要性。这直接影响了我们后续项目的技术规范和测试投入,我们引入了PerfDog进行持续监控,并在CI流程中加入了自动化压测环节。”

解析:

考察目的:此问题旨在全面评估候选人的实际解决问题的能力、技术深度和广度、沟通协作能力、项目管理和领导潜力以及反思和学习能力。通过具体案例,面试官可以深入了解候选人在压力下如何工作,如何将技术方案落地,如何带领或作为核心成员推动问题解决,以及其职业发展和成长的轨迹。

评估要点:

解决问题的能力:是否展现了系统化的分析思维、定位问题的能力、以及创新能力?

沟通与协作:描述中是否体现了有效沟通、团队协作、积极协调资源?管理风格如何?

结果导向:能否量化解决方案的效果?是否关注最终结果和业务价值?

反思与成长:是否从经历中总结经验教训?这些经验如何指导未来的行为?这体现了候选人的学习和发展潜力。

STAR原则应用:候选的回答是否清晰、有条理,是否遵循了Situation(情境)、Task(任务)、Action(行动)、Result(结果)的结构?如果结构混乱,也反映了其逻辑思维和表达能力。

追问可能性:面试官可能会基于回答进行追问,例如:

谁参与了这个问题解决?你在其中扮演了什么角色?

解决方案当时还有没有其他的备选方案?为什么最终选择了这个方案?

如果重新来过,你会怎么做?

这个项目具体用了什么技术栈?

第二题:

请谈谈你如何进行团队的技术指导和支持?请举例说明你曾经是如何帮助团队成员解决技术难题的。

答案:

进行团队的技术指导和支持是工程师主管的核心职责之一。有效的技术指导和支持不仅能够帮助团队成员解决眼前的技术难题,更能促进团队整体技术能力的提

文档评论(0)

文库新人 + 关注
实名认证
文档贡献者

文库新人

1亿VIP精品文档

相关文档